Job Description

Description

The Associate General Counsel will partner with technical and business teams to navigate new technology developments and provide expert advice on intellectual property (IP) matters. This role involves designing and implementing IP strategies that ensure asset protection and alignment with business objectives. You will be tasked with identifying and harvesting inventions across various technological domains, particularly in cyber and artificial intelligence. Responsibilities include reviewing invention disclosures and overseeing patent application preparation and prosecution with external patent counsel. Additionally, you will manage IP disputes and engage in IP diligence related to potential acquisitions, equity investments, and divestitures.
